ADL To Honor 4 Execs

By Staff -- TWICE, 9/17/2007

NEW YORK — The Anti-Defamation League's National Consumer Technology Industry will hold its annual dinner dance, here, on Saturday, Nov. 17, and honor four leading industry executives.

The American Heritage Award will be given to Elmer Karl, chairman/president of Karl's TV & Appliance. The Patricia Rienzi Legacy Award will go to Don Patrican, executive VP, Maxell Corp. of America; the S. David Feir Humanitarian Award will be presented to Sam Abdelnour, sales VP of Whirlpool's North American region. The Torch of Liberty Award will be presented to Eric Schwartz, group president and publishing director for the Consumer Technology Publishing Group/NAPCO.

Brad Anderson, vice chair of Best Buy, will serve as ADL industry chair along with dinner chairs Warren Mann of Haier America and Mike Vitelli of Best Buy for the event.
